-4

「部屋」と「オブジェクトコード」が等しい「カウント」フィールドをまとめたいと思います。

何か案は?

ここに画像の説明を入力

4

1 に答える 1

4

あなたのコンテキストがどのように設定されているか、テーブル名は何か、質問に答えるために必要な他の多くのことはわかりませんがGroupBy、次のようなLINQメソッドを確実に使用します。

var results = db.TableName.GroupBy(x => new { x.Room, x.ObjectCode })
                          .Select(g => new { g.Key.Room, g.Key.ObjectCode, Count = g.Sum(x => x.Code) })
                          .ToList();
于 2013-08-26T12:25:58.437 に答える